本文分享自华为云社区《当创建一个service后,kubernetes会发生什么?》,作者:可以交个朋友。一、Service介绍1.1Kubernetes为什么会引入service?考虑到集群中Pod实例IP地址随着工作负载的生命周期的变化,常规通过访问Pod实例的IP方法变得不再实用。每个工作负载通常有一个或者更多个后端Pod实例,如何将流量请求做到负载均衡转发也是迫在眉睫。1.2Service概念service用于一组提供服务、具有相同labelPod的抽象集合的网络访问地址(包括网络协议IPv4/IPv6地址和服务域名地址),提供集群内/外访问通信,屏蔽后端实例Pod信息并为后端Pod实
本文分享自华为云社区《当创建一个service后,kubernetes会发生什么?》,作者:可以交个朋友。一、Service介绍1.1Kubernetes为什么会引入service?考虑到集群中Pod实例IP地址随着工作负载的生命周期的变化,常规通过访问Pod实例的IP方法变得不再实用。每个工作负载通常有一个或者更多个后端Pod实例,如何将流量请求做到负载均衡转发也是迫在眉睫。1.2Service概念service用于一组提供服务、具有相同labelPod的抽象集合的网络访问地址(包括网络协议IPv4/IPv6地址和服务域名地址),提供集群内/外访问通信,屏蔽后端实例Pod信息并为后端Pod实
文章目录@[toc]下载官方yaml文件修改yaml文件修改service端口修改clusterrolebinding修改deployment内容修改探针检测修改镜像拉取策略修改容器端口关闭token登录增加ingress完整版yaml下载官方yaml文件最后有完整版的yaml文件,不想看细节的话,可以拉到最后取yaml内容[还是建议看看修改了哪些比较好]可以根据自己的需求选择版本wgethttps://raw.githubusercontent.com/kubernetes/dashboard/v2.7.0/aio/deploy/recommended.yaml修改yaml文件在docker
环境要求操作系统:CentOS7.x64位Kubernetes版本:v1.16.2Docker版本:19.03.13-ceFlink版本:1.14.3使用中国YUM及镜像源 1.安装Kubernetes:1.1创建文件:/etc/yum.repos.d/kubernetes.repo,内容如下:[kubernetes]name=Kubernetesbaseurl=https://mirrors.aliyun.com/kubernetes/yum/repos/kubernetes-el7-x86_64/enabled=1gpgcheck=1repo_gpgcheck=1gpgkey=https:
1环境准备1.1主机信息iphostname10.220.43.203ops-master-110.220.43.204ops-worker-110.220.43.205ops-worker-21.2系统信息$cat/etc/redhat-releaseAlibabaCloudLinux(AliyunLinux)release2.1903LTS(HuntingBeagle)2部署准备master/与worker主机均需要设置。2.1设置主机名#ops-master-1hostnamectlset-hostnameops-master-1#ops-worker-1hostnamectlset-h
一、查看集群状态在Elasticsearch8.x中,可以使用以下2种方法来检查集群的状态:1、通过RESTAPI查看:使用Elasticsearch提供的RESTAPI,可以通过向任意节点发送HTTP请求来检查集群的状态。常见的API端点是_cluster/health。Elasticsearch提供了丰富的RESTAPI,用于与集群进行交互。以下是一些常用的ElasticsearchRESTAPI端点:集群健康信息:获取集群的健康状况:GET/_cluster/health获取集群的详细信息:GET/_cluster/state节点信息:获取节点信息:GET/_cat/nodesX-Pac
kubeSphere集群部署ElasticSearch根据docker启动文件来配置修改max_map_count添加配置文件创建工作负载测试根据docker启动文件来配置dockerrun-d\--namees\-e"ES_JAVA_OPTS=-Xms512m-Xmx512m"\-e"discovery.type=single-node"\-ves-data:/usr/share/elasticsearch/data\-ves-config:/usr/share/elasticsearch/config\--privileged\--networkes-net\-p9200:9200\-p9
概述 在使用es中如果遇到了集群不可写入或者部分索引状态unassigned,明明写入了很多数据但是查不到等等系列问题该怎么办呢?咱们今天一起看下常用运维命令。案例 起初我们es性能还跟得上,随着业务发展壮大,发现查询性能越来越不行了,我们可以通过catapi查看索引的segments情况,比如下图: 如果发现索引的segment段过多,并且每个段数据量很小,那么就可以通过合并段的措施来提升检索性能。 那么我们在大批量迁移的时候,发现数据明明写入了但是少了很多?这是为什么呢,咱们还是可以通过catapi查看下线程池的状态,如下图: 通过查看写入线程池的状态观测是不是达到集群最大
【云原生之kubernetes实战】在k8s环境下部署WBO在线协作白板一、WBO介绍1.1WBO简介1.2WBO特点二、kubernetes介绍2.1kubernetes简介2.2kubernetes特点三、本次实践介绍3.1本次实践简介3.2本次环境规划四、检查k8s环境4.1检查工作节点状态4.2检查系统pod状态五、编辑wbo.yaml文件5.1创
作者:櫰木本次集群规划信息本次实际生产业务体量存在巨大差异,但集群规划内容相同,因此建议实际生产环境按照按照一定比例扩展即可。主机操作系统要求软件信息参数配置8C16G操作系统版本CentOSLinuxrelease7.8.2003(Core)java版本javaversion"1.8.0_281"hadoop版本hadoop3.2.4集群版本规划集群组建版本HDFS3.2.4YARN3.2.4MapReduce23.2.4Hive3.1.2HBase2.1.0ZooKeeper3.7.1Trino389主机角色规划服务器IP角色hd1.dtstack.com(管理节点)172.16.104.